仓库管理系统工程文件的编制与实施指南:如何高效构建企业物流核心系统
在当今智能制造和数字化转型浪潮中,仓库管理系统(WMS)已成为企业供应链管理的核心组成部分。一个结构清晰、内容详实的仓库管理系统工程文件,不仅是项目立项、设计开发、测试验收和后期运维的依据,更是保障系统稳定运行、满足业务需求的关键文档。本文将深入探讨仓库管理系统工程文件的编制流程、关键要素、常见问题及最佳实践,帮助企业在项目初期就打下坚实基础。
一、什么是仓库管理系统工程文件?
仓库管理系统工程文件是指围绕WMS项目的全生命周期所形成的标准化技术文档集合,涵盖从需求分析、系统设计、开发实现到测试部署、用户培训和维护更新等各个阶段的详细记录。它不仅是项目团队内部沟通的桥梁,也是客户、监理单位或审计部门验证项目合规性和质量的重要依据。
这类文件通常包括但不限于:
• 需求规格说明书(SRS)
• 系统架构设计文档
• 数据库设计说明
• 接口规范文档
• 测试用例与报告
• 用户操作手册
• 项目进度计划与里程碑表
• 变更控制记录
二、为什么必须重视仓库管理系统工程文件?
很多企业在推进WMS建设时往往重功能轻文档,认为“代码跑通就行”。然而,忽视工程文件会导致以下严重后果:
- 项目失控风险增加:缺乏统一标准导致开发方向偏离业务目标;
- 后期维护困难:无文档支持的新员工难以快速上手,故障排查效率低下;
- 验收障碍重重:客户无法确认是否达到预期效果,易引发纠纷;
- 知识资产流失:一旦项目负责人离职,宝贵经验无法传承。
因此,高质量的工程文件是WMS项目成功的基石,尤其在大型制造、电商、医药等行业中更为重要。
三、仓库管理系统工程文件的主要组成部分
1. 项目启动阶段文档
此阶段的核心任务是明确项目边界与目标,主要输出如下:
- 项目建议书:阐述为何需要建设WMS,预计收益与投资回报率(ROI);
- 可行性研究报告:从技术、经济、法律三个维度评估项目的可落地性;
- 项目章程:定义项目经理、干系人职责、预算范围与时间表。
2. 需求分析阶段文档
这是整个工程文件中最关键的一环。需通过访谈、问卷、现场观察等方式收集真实业务场景,并形成结构化文档:
- 业务流程图(BPMN):可视化展示入库、出库、盘点、移库等核心流程;
- 功能需求列表:按模块划分,如库存管理、批次追踪、RFID集成、报表中心等;
- 非功能性需求:性能指标(并发用户数、响应时间)、安全性要求(权限分级、日志审计)。
示例:某快消品企业提出“每日峰值订单处理能力不低于5000单”,即为典型的性能类非功能性需求。
3. 系统设计阶段文档
由架构师主导完成,确保技术方案匹配业务复杂度:
- 系统架构图:展示前后端分离、微服务拆分、数据库主从架构等;
- 数据库ER图与字段说明:如商品主数据表、仓位信息表、作业流水表;
- API接口文档(Swagger格式):用于与其他系统(ERP、TMS)对接;
- 安全设计说明:角色权限模型(RBAC)、数据加密策略、防SQL注入措施。
4. 开发与测试阶段文档
此阶段注重过程留痕与质量管控:
- 编码规范:统一命名规则、注释风格、异常处理机制;
- 单元测试报告:覆盖每个函数逻辑路径;
- 集成测试用例:模拟多系统协同下的数据流转;
- UAT用户验收测试记录:由最终用户签字确认功能符合预期。
5. 上线与运维阶段文档
确保系统平稳过渡并长期可用:
- 部署手册:包含服务器配置、环境变量设置、依赖包安装步骤;
- 应急预案:如断电恢复、数据备份策略、灾备切换流程;
- 培训材料:视频教程、PPT讲义、FAQ常见问题解答;
- 变更管理记录:每次版本迭代都需登记修改内容、影响范围。
四、编写仓库管理系统工程文件的实用技巧
1. 使用模板标准化输出
推荐使用ISO/IEC/IEEE 29148标准或国内《软件文档编制规范》作为参考模板,避免重复劳动。例如,可以创建Excel表格模板用于填写功能点清单,Markdown格式用于撰写API文档,提升协作效率。
2. 强调图文结合增强可读性
不要只写文字!用流程图、时序图、界面原型图辅助理解。比如,在描述“拣货路径优化算法”时,附上一张带箭头的仓库平面图,比纯文字描述直观十倍。
3. 建立版本控制系统(Git)
所有文档应纳入Git仓库管理,每次提交都要有清晰备注(如:v1.2-新增退货流程说明),便于追溯历史版本,防止混乱。
4. 定期评审与闭环反馈
每完成一个阶段文档后,组织跨部门评审会(产品、开发、测试、运营),及时发现遗漏或矛盾点。例如,测试人员可能指出某接口未考虑超时场景,应在文档中补充说明。
五、常见误区与解决方案
误区一:文档是“做完再说”的事后补救工作
❌ 错误做法:等到开发完成后才开始整理文档,结果发现大量细节遗忘。
✅ 正确做法:边开发边记录,采用敏捷开发中的“Story Mapping”方法,让文档随迭代同步演进。
误区二:文档越厚越好,堆砌冗余内容
❌ 错误做法:把每个按钮的功能都写成几百字,反而让人看不清重点。
✅ 正确做法:聚焦关键决策点和难点,采用摘要+附件的形式,如“总体设计→详细设计→代码片段”三层结构。
误区三:只给技术人员看,不面向业务用户
❌ 错误做法:用户手册全是术语,一线员工看不懂。
✅ 正确做法:提供两种版本——技术版供IT团队查阅,通俗版供仓库管理员使用,甚至制作短视频讲解高频操作。
六、案例分享:某汽车零部件企业的成功实践
该企业在导入WMS前,因文档缺失导致两次失败。第三次重新启动时,成立了专门的文档小组,制定了《WMS工程文件编写手册》,并强制执行“文档先行”原则。最终项目提前两周上线,用户满意度达98%,且后续两年内几乎没有重大故障发生。
关键动作包括:
• 每周召开一次文档审查会议
• 所有需求变更必须先更新SRS再开发
• 每个模块上线前必须通过UAT测试并签署确认书
七、结语:让工程文件成为企业的数字资产
仓库管理系统工程文件不是负担,而是企业数字化转型过程中最宝贵的无形资产。它不仅支撑当前项目的顺利交付,更为未来扩展、升级乃至AI赋能(如智能补货预测)奠定坚实基础。建议企业将文档管理纳入IT治理范畴,设立专职文档工程师岗位,推动从“做项目”向“建能力”的转变。
记住:优秀的系统,始于清晰的文档;卓越的企业,始于系统的沉淀。

